Demolition for a residential development in Orange, Texas. Completed plans call for the demolition of a residential development.

Sealed bids are requested to furnish all materials, supplies, tools, equipment, supervision, and labor necessary to complete the demolition and removal of substandard structures at twenty-nine locations as specified in the contract documents. Each property will be awarded separately. The employer is an Affirmative Action/Equal Opportunity Employer. Removal of all structures located on the subject property, including residences. The fence clearly belonging to the property must be removed. 2. Removal and disposal of all contents of all structures located on said properties, including but not limited to housewares, appliances, finishes, construction materials, tools, furniture, and fixtures. 3. Vehicles subject to the Junk Vehicle Ordinance and the Vehicle Code (cars, trucks, vans, motorcycles, boats, boat motors, or parts thereof) located on the properties shall not be removed from the property as part of this contract. However, if such vehicle(s) impede the removal of a structure or debris, the vehicle may be relocated to another part of the property. The Contractor shall make every effort to avoid further damage to the vehicle by moving it and shall contact the Code Enforcement Officer prior to moving any vehicle(s) so that the condition can be documented. 4. Towable trailers, towable RVs, Camper shells, and non-identifiable vehicle parts (tires, batteries) and components are not considered to be vehicles under the cited ordinance and shall be removed as part of the work. 5. All trash, junk, and debris shall be removed from the site, whether it is located inside a structure or elsewhere on the property. 6. All concrete slabs, sidewalks, driveways, and steps shall be demolished and removed. Footings, foundations, or other structures protruding above grade shall be removed. Concrete driveways and sidewalks to the front door will be removed to the City easement and will be marked by theCity. 7. All demolition debris, contents, trash, and junk shall be disposed of properly. Manifests for any contaminated or asbestos-containing waste shall be provided in accordance with DSHS and NESHAP regulations. Dump tickets, manifests, or other evidence of proper disposal for all materials may be required to be submitted prior to the release of retainage for the project. If the Contractor hires another firm to handle disposal, that Subcontractor is responsible for providing such proof to the general Contractor for submittal to the City. In no case shall the Contractor assign his responsibility for proof of disposal to a Subcontractor or other entity 8. All living trees with a trunk diameter greater than six inches (6") shall be left in place unless the structure(s) cannot be removed with the trees in place. Dead trees with trunk diameters in excess of six inches (6") shall be removed. Brush and saplings located within or adjacent to the work area shall be removed and disposed of. In the event that trees with trunk diameters larger than six inches are severely damaged during the work, they shall be removed by the contractor as part of the work. Any branches or limbs that are damaged during the work shall be neatly removed from trees to remain. Removal and disposal of trees, branches, and cuttings is the responsibility of the Contractor. Any downed tree, living or dead laying on the ground must be cut up and removed. 9. Contractor shall comply with Texas "call before you dig" requirements. 10. Electrical service to the structure shall be terminated by the City and secured at the pole feeding the property prior to the start of any demolition work. Meters and other equipment not removed by the electrical provider shall be removed and disposed of properly by the Contractor. 11. The sewer and water connections shall be terminated and capped in a manner approved by the Orange Public Works Department. Sanitary facilities in the structures to be demolished shall not be utilized by the Contractor or his employees. 12. Service and meter shall be removed by the gas company prior to the start of demolition work. Removal of visible components for gas service should be verified by the Contractor for each house prior to the start of work. 13. After demolition work is completed to the satisfaction of the Code Enforcement Officer, the site shall be rough graded so that pits, holes, or obvious areas subject to ponding of water are mitigated, asnecessary.
